49er tennis sweeps UTEP, Portland


Staff Reports

Laura ThomasUniversity of Portland had no chance against the 49ers Saturday as Long Beach State swept the Pilots 7-0 to move the tennis team record to 9-5 for the season.
 
Alena Kovalchuk lead The Beach in singles play as she dispatched Portland’s Amy Juppenlatz 6-1, 6-1. With the win Kovalchuk has extended her unbeaten streak in singles matches to seven games and has not been defeated in the No.1 singles spot this season.
 
Kovalchuk’s 49er teammates joined her to sweep all six singles matches.
 
Laura Thomas defeated Kaori Tanabe 6-2, 6-4. In the third singles match, 49er Lindsey Marvel stopped Sanja Indic 6-1, 6-1, while Claudia Argumedo had little trouble finishing Alyson Tyson 6-1, 6-1 in the No.4 singles match.
 
Kelly Chan put two strong sets together to rout Portland’s Kelle Menke 6-1. 6-1 and freshman Alanah Carroll continued her stellar play as she won her No.6 match 6-0, 6-2 over Diedre Ring-Marrinson.
 
The win for Carroll has made it nine consecutive singles matches without a loss, while Chan has now won six out of her last seven singles matches.
 
Long Beach State also made it a clean sweep in doubles play, winning all three matches.
 
The 49er duo of Marvel and Kovalchuk continued to roll as they beat Juppenlatz and Indic 8-3. In the second doubles match Laura Thomas and Kelly Chan matched the performance of Kovalchuk and Marvel as they bested Tanabe and Tyson 9-7 in a hard fought match.
 
Argumedo and Carroll then capped the sweep with an 8-0 drubbing of Portland’s Menke and Ring-Marrinson in the final doubles match.
 
In other tennis action 74th ranked LBSU also dispatched the University Texas at El Paso tennis team 7-0 Thursday at the 49er Campus Courts.
 
The Beach has now won nine of its last 11 matches and has gone 4-0 against Big West conference opponents in that span. The 49ers return to action this Thursday against Boise State at the 49er Campus Courts.
